Responsibility
- Lead month-end and year-end close processes, ensuring timely and accurate financial reporting in compliance with US GAAP.
- Prepare, review, and post journal entries, accruals, and reconciliations with meticulous attention to detail.
- Perform balance sheet and income statement account reconciliations, identifying and resolving discrepancies.
- Collaborate with internal teams to streamline accounting processes and improve efficiency.
- Assist in the preparation of financial statements, reports, and presentations for management and stakeholders.
- Ensure compliance with internal controls, policies, and regulatory requirements.
- Provide support during audits, including preparing documentation and responding to auditor inquiries.
- Mentor junior accounting staff and contribute to their professional development.
Qualifications
- Bachelorâs degree in Accounting, Finance, or a related field; CPA or equivalent certification is a plus.
- Minimum of 5 years of experience in accounting, with at least 2 years in a senior or supervisory role.
- Strong knowledge of US GAAP and experience with month-end close processes.
- Advanced proficiency in Microsoft Excel (e.g., pivot tables, VLOOKUP, macros) and accounting software (e.g., QuickBooks, NetSuite, SAP).
- Excellent analytical skills with the ability to interpret financial data and provide actionable insights.
- Strong communication skills, both written and verbal, with the ability to collaborate effectively in a remote environment.
- Detail-oriented mindset with a commitment to accuracy and quality in financial reporting.
- Ability to work independently, manage multiple priorities, and meet deadlines in a fast-paced environment.
